Abstract
The small-strain shear modulus (G max ) is a soil property that has many practical applications. The authors compiled a database of G max measurements for 40 normally consolidated to slightly overconsolidated low to high plasticity clays. Using these data, the authors propose a semi-empirical relationship between G max , effective stress (σ'v or σ'c), preconsolidation stress (σ'p) and in-situ void ratio (e0) for four ranges of plasticity index...
